1 It happened at that time that Judah moved away from his brothers and stayed with an Adullamite, whose name was Hirah.
And it came to pass at that time, that Judah went down from his brethren, and turned in to a certain Adullamite, whose name [was] Hirah.
2 There Judah saw the daughter of a Canaanite whose name was Shua. And he married her and slept with her.
And Judah saw there a daughter of a certain Canaanite, whose name [was] Shuah; and he took her, and went in to her.
3 She conceived and gave birth to a son, and he named him Er.
And she conceived, and bore a son; and he called his name Er.
4 She conceived again and gave birth to a son, and she named him Onan.
And she conceived again, and bore a son; and she called his name Onan.
5 Then she gave birth to another son, and named him Shelah. And he was at Kezib when she gave birth to him.
And she yet again conceived, and bore a son; and called his name Shelah: and he was at Chezib, when she bore him.
6 And Judah got a wife for Er, his firstborn, and her name was Tamar.
And Judah took a wife for Er his first-born, whose name [was] Tamar.
7 Now Er, Judah's firstborn, was wicked in the sight of the LORD, so God killed him.
And Er, Judah's first-born, was wicked in the sight of the LORD; and the LORD slew him.
8 Then Judah said to Onan, "Sleep with your brother's wife and fulfill the duty of a brother-in-law to her, and raise up offspring for your brother."
And Judah said to Onan, Go in to thy brother's wife, and marry her, and raise up seed to thy brother.
9 But Onan knew that the offspring wouldn't be his. So it happened when he slept with his brother's wife that he released his semen on the ground, so that he would not produce offspring for his brother.
And Onan knew that the seed would not be his: and it came to pass, when he went in to his brother's wife, that he frustrated the purpose, lest he should give seed to his brother.
10 And what he did was evil in the sight of God, so he killed him also.
And the thing which he did displeased the LORD: wherefore he slew him also.
11 Then Judah said to his daughter-in-law Tamar, "Remain a widow in your father's house until my son Shelah is grown up." For he thought, "I do not want him to die too, like his brothers." So Tamar went and lived in her father's house.
Then said Judah to Tamar his daughter-in-law, Remain a widow at thy father's house, till Shelah my son shall be grown; (for he said, Lest perhaps he die also as his brethren [did]: ) and Tamar went and dwelt in her father's house.
12 After some time, Judah's wife, the daughter of Shua, died. And Judah finished mourning, and went up to his sheepshearers at Timnah, he and his friend Hirah the Adullamite.
And in process of time, the daughter of Shuah Judah's wife died: and Judah was comforted, and went up to his sheep-shearers to Timnath, he and his friend Hirah the Adullamite.
13 And Tamar was told, saying, "Look, your father-in-law is going up to Timnah to shear his sheep."
And it was told to Tamar, saying, Behold, thy father-in-law goeth up to Timnath, to shear his sheep.
14 She took off her widow's clothes and covered herself with a veil, and wrapped herself, and sat at the entrance to Enaim, which is on the way to Timnah. For she saw that Shelah was grown up, and she had not been given to him as a wife.
And she put off from her, her widow's garments, and covered her with a vail, and wrapped herself, and sat in an open place, which [is] by the way to Timnath: for she saw that Shelah was grown, and she was not given to him for a wife.
15 When Judah saw her, he thought that she was a prostitute because she had covered her face.
When Judah saw her, he thought her [to be] a harlot; because she had covered her face.
16 He went over to her by the road and said, "Please come, let me sleep with you," for he did not know that she was his daughter-in-law. She said, "What will you give me for sleeping with you?"
And he turned to her by the way, and said, Come, I pray thee, let me have access to thee; (for he knew not that she [was] his daughter-in-law: ) and she said, What wilt thou give me, that thou mayst have access to me?
17 He said, "I will send you a young goat from the flock." She said, "Will you give me something as a guarantee until you send it?"
And he said, I will send [thee] a kid from the flock: and she said, Wilt thou give [me] a pledge, till thou sendest [it]?
18 He said, "What kind of guarantee should I give you?" She replied, "Your signet and your cord and your staff that is in your hand." So he gave them to her, and slept with her, and she became pregnant by him.
And he said, What pledge shall I give thee? and she said, Thy signet, and thy bracelets, and thy staff that [is] in thy hand: and he gave [them to] her, and came in to her, and she conceived by him.
19 And she got up and left, and took off her veil, and put on her widow's clothing.
And she arose and went her way and laid by her vail from her, and put on the garments of her widowhood.
20 Judah sent the young goat by his friend, the Adullamite, to receive the guarantee back from the woman's hand, but he did not find her.
And Judah sent the kid by the hand of his friend the Adullamite, to receive [his] pledge from the woman's hand: but he found her not.
21 Then he asked the men of the place, saying, "Where is the prostitute that was at Enaim by the road?" They said, "There has been no prostitute here."
Then he asked the men of that place, saying, where [is] the harlot that [was] openly by the way-side? and they said, There was no harlot in this [place].
22 He returned to Judah, and said, "I haven't found her; and also the men of the place said, 'There has been no prostitute here.'"
And he returned to Judah, and said, I cannot find her; and also the men of the place said, [that] there was no harlot in this [place].
23 Judah said, "Let her keep the things, lest we be publicly shamed. Look, I sent this young goat, but you did not find her."
And Judah said, Let her take [it] to her, lest we be shamed: behold, I sent this kid, and thou hast not found her.
24 Now it happened about three months later that Judah was told, saying, "Tamar, your daughter-in-law, has turned to prostitution, and now, look, she is pregnant by prostitution." Judah said, "Bring her out, and let her be burned."
And it came to pass about three months after, that it was told to Judah, saying, Tamar thy daughter-in-law hath played the harlot; and also, behold she [is] with child by lewdness: and Judah said, Bring her forth, and let her be burnt.
25 When she was brought out, she sent word to her father-in-law, saying, "By the man who owns these I am pregnant." She also said, "Please discern whose these are—the signet, and the cord, and the staff."
When she [was] brought forth, she sent to her father-in-law, saying, By the man whose these [are], am I with child: and she said, Discern, I pray thee, whose [are] these, the signet, and bracelets, and staff.
26 Then Judah recognized them, and said, "She is more righteous than I, since I did not give her to my son Shelah." He did not sleep with her again.
And Judah acknowledged [them], and said She hath been more righteous than I; because that I gave her not to Shelah my son: and he knew her again no more.
27 It happened when it was time for her to give birth, that look, there were twins in her womb.
And it came to pass in the time of her travail, that behold, twins [were] in her womb.
28 As she was in labor, one put out a hand, and the midwife took a scarlet thread and tied it on his hand, saying, "This one came out first."
And it came to pass when she travailed, that [the one] put out [his] hand; and the midwife took and bound upon his hand a scarlet thread, saying, This came out first.
29 It happened, as he drew back his hand, that look, his brother came out, and she said, "How did you break through?" So he was named Perez.
And it came to pass as he drew back his hand, that behold, his brother came out; and she said, How hast thou broken forth? [this] breach [be] upon thee: therefore his name was called Pharez.
30 Afterward his brother came out, that had the scarlet thread on his hand, so he was named Zerah.
And afterwards came out his brother that had the scarlet thread upon his hand; and his name was called Zarah.
